Project Profile
Location: Offshore East Java
Peak production: 300 million cubic feet per day of gas
Start-up year: 2012
The TSB Uqbar project is expected to reach a peak production rate of 300 million cubic feet per day of gas, which will be exported to the East Java Gas Pipeline.
The companies that make up Kangean Energy are Indonesia’s Energi Mega Persada (50%), Mitsubishi Corporation (25%) and Japan Petroleum Exploration (25%).

Contractor:
BW Offshore: EPC contract
Dril-Quip (subsidiary Dril-Quip Asia Pacific Pte Ltd): to supply subsea drilling and production equipment and related services for the development of Terang/Sirasun/Batur gas fields.
- subsea wellhead systems, subsea tree systems, subsea control systems and other equipment for the project. (July, 2016)
Timas Suplindo: Contracted for the engineering and installation of rigid pipelines, four segments of infield flexible flowlines and several subsea umbilicals. It also involves the tie-in of flexible pipes and umbilicals to christmas trees and the tie-in of the TSB-2 flowline and subsea control system to the existing TSB phase one system. (February, 2017)
